Step 7: Migrate the waveform preview renderer. The new Soundline preview service generates audio waveforms ahead of playback rather than on demand, so the migration involves backfilling previews for the existing library. Run the backfill in batches during off-peak hours; each batch emits a completion metric you should watch, and any failed render is retried twice before landing in the dead-letter queue. Pause the backfill immediately if render latency exceeds the alert threshold. Before starting, verify the worker pool is using these settings.

config for kagup-hahig:
druwyn:
  pin: 2801
  metrics_host: metrics.druwyn.zemvarlabs.internal
  tenant: sorius
  seal: seal_798a43d7

Handover — Velmora Unit Sale

Quick rundown for the branch managers' briefing: the Velmora instruments unit is going to Castellan Group, closing expected end of Q2. Staffing stays put until transition day; keep messaging to the approved script. Darla has the diligence binder. The real reasoning behind the timing is captured in the note below.

internal memo for tajof-kaduf: Only 65 of the 511 pilot accounts renewed Lamdor, so a churn review is set for January 26. Aldmirek Works is in early talks to buy Alddorox Works for about $490.9 million.

**Alert: SeatScribe renderer latency exceeded threshold.** The seat-map renderer for the Foxglove Theatre booking flow is taking longer than two seconds to draw the orchestra level. Customers may see blank seat grids and abandon checkout. Check the tile cache hit rate first; a cold cache after deploys is the usual cause. Detailed diagnosis steps and the restart procedure are on the page below.

runbook for badug-kadup: https://confluence.zemvarlabs.internal/projects/browse/display/projects/bd1b